+ Bedrock uses the AWS SDK default credential chain — no API keys needed. If OpenClaw runs on EC2 with a Bedrock-enabled instance role, just set the provider and model:

+ **Supported models** (with family detection and dimension defaults):
-The following models are supported (with family detection and dimension
-defaults):
+ | Model ID | Provider | Default Dims | Configurable Dims |
+ | ------------------------------------------ | ---------- | ------------ | -------------------- |
+ | `amazon.titan-embed-text-v2:0` | Amazon | 1024 | 256, 512, 1024 |
+ | `amazon.titan-embed-text-v1` | Amazon | 1536 | -- |
+ | `amazon.titan-embed-g1-text-02` | Amazon | 1536 | -- |
+ | `amazon.titan-embed-image-v1` | Amazon | 1024 | -- |
+ | `amazon.nova-2-multimodal-embeddings-v1:0` | Amazon | 1024 | 256, 384, 1024, 3072 |
+ | `cohere.embed-english-v3` | Cohere | 1024 | -- |
+ | `cohere.embed-multilingual-v3` | Cohere | 1024 | -- |
+ | `cohere.embed-v4:0` | Cohere | 1536 | 256-1536 |
+ | `twelvelabs.marengo-embed-3-0-v1:0` | TwelveLabs | 512 | -- |
+ | `twelvelabs.marengo-embed-2-7-v1:0` | TwelveLabs | 1024 | -- |

+ **Authentication:** Bedrock auth uses the standard AWS SDK credential resolution order:
-### Authentication
+ 1. Environment variables (`AWS_ACCESS_KEY_ID` + `AWS_SECRET_ACCESS_KEY`)
+ 2. SSO token cache
+ 3. Web identity token credentials
+ 4. Shared credentials and config files
+ 5. ECS or EC2 metadata credentials
-Bedrock auth uses the standard AWS SDK credential resolution order:
+ Region is resolved from `AWS_REGION`, `AWS_DEFAULT_REGION`, the `amazon-bedrock` provider `baseUrl`, or defaults to `us-east-1`.

-Unset uses the provider default: 600 seconds for local/self-hosted providers
-such as `local`, `ollama`, and `lmstudio`, and 120 seconds for hosted providers.
-
-Increase this when local CPU-bound embedding batches are healthy but slow.
+Unset uses the provider default: 600 seconds for local/self-hosted providers such as `local`, `ollama`, and `lmstudio`, and 120 seconds for hosted providers. Increase this when local CPU-bound embedding batches are healthy but slow.

+Paths can be absolute or workspace-relative. Directories are scanned recursively for `.md` files. Symlink handling depends on the active backend: the builtin engine ignores symlinks, while QMD follows the underlying QMD scanner behavior.

## QMD backend config
-Set `memory.backend = "qmd"` to enable. All QMD settings live under
-`memory.qmd`:
+Set `memory.backend = "qmd"` to enable. All QMD settings live under `memory.qmd`:

+OpenClaw prefers the current QMD collection and MCP query shapes, but keeps older QMD releases working by falling back to legacy `--mask` collection flags and older MCP tool names when needed.
-QMD model overrides stay on the QMD side, not OpenClaw config. If you need to
-override QMD's models globally, set environment variables such as
-`QMD_EMBED_MODEL`, `QMD_RERANK_MODEL`, and `QMD_GENERATE_MODEL` in the gateway
-runtime environment.
+
+QMD model overrides stay on the QMD side, not OpenClaw config. If you need to override QMD's models globally, set environment variables such as `QMD_EMBED_MODEL`, `QMD_RERANK_MODEL`, and `QMD_GENERATE_MODEL` in the gateway runtime environment.
